All rights reserved. http://usgwarchives.net/copyright.htm http://usgwarchives.net/la/lafiles.htm ********************************************** Rev. George Clarence Berly The Rev. George Clarence Berly, 89, died Wednesday, Nov. 15, 2000, in Dowlen Oaks Assisted Living Community in Beaumont, Texas. The Rev. Berly was a native of Robeline, and was a retired postmaster in Marthaville. He was a retired Baptist minister, having served at Anthony Baptist Church near Robeline, Springridge Baptist Church near Pleasant Hill, Cedar Grove Baptist Church near Many, and Rocky Springs Baptist Church in Marthaville. He served as a deacon at First Baptist Church in Marthaville, before entering the ministry. He was a member of First Baptist Church in Marthaville. He was a veteran of World War II, serving in the U. S. Army. Funeral services were held at 1 p.m., Saturday, Nov. 18, at First Baptist Church in Marthaville, with interment following at the Marthaville Cemetery. The Rev. Bob Salley officiated. Survivors include his widow of 68 years, Ruby Barnhill Berly of Marthaville; two daughters, Bonnie Rutherford of Westlake, and Betty Stevens of Beaumont, Texas; two brothers, Robert Berly of Campti, and Edwin Berly of DeRidder; four grandchildren, Gloria Reidlinger of Kingwood, Texas, Elizabeth Davis, and Lisa Chapman, both of Dallas, Texas, and Michael Stevens of Valdez, Alaska; three great grandchildren, Amy Reidlinger, and Caleb Reidlinger, both of Kingwood, Texas, and Michael J.
